We classify noncompact homogeneous spaces which are Einstein and asymptotically harmonic. This completes the classification of Riemannian harmonic spaces in the homogeneous case: Any simply connected homogeneous harmonic space is flat, or rank-one symmetric, or a nonsymmetric Damek-Ricci space. We use the density function of a harmonic space to obtain estimates for the eigenvalues of the Jacobi operator; when these estimates are sharp, then the harmonic space is a symmetric Osserman space.

A Riemannian manifold is called harmonic if its volume density function expressed in polar coordinates centered at any point is radial. Flat and rank-one symmetric spaces are harmonic. The converse (the Lichnerowicz Conjecture) is true for manifolds of nonnegative scalar curvature and for some other classes of manifold…
